NFL Betting: Arizona Cardinals at NY Giants

Larry Fitzgerald might enjoy himself against a beleagured Giants defence

The Giants got a fearful beating last week while the Cards aren't much good on the road, yet both are challenging for NFC dominance. So who will come out on top?

Despite conceding 48 point last week, the New York Giants somehow still own the top-ranked defence in the NFL. While that may be the case, Kurt Warner, Larry Fitzgerald and the Arizona Cardinals are probably excited by what they saw from New York's beleaguered defensive unit at New Orleans.

The last two NFC champions meet on Sunday night at Giants Stadium, with the Cardinals seeking a third straight victory and the Giants still smarting from their first loss of the season.

If New York's pass rush which had proved so effective until last week doesn't fire again then Kurt Warner who has been better protected by his offensive line of late will produce a similar result to that which Drew Brees did last week for the New Orleans Saints. The Giants gave up 34 points in the first half and 493 yards for the game - their highest total allowed since the Cardinals gained 495 on Nov. 11, 1988. Pressure is the key for the Giants this week and they must generate some to protect a much banged up secondary.

If they don't, Larry Fitzgerald, who is gradually finding his stride, will take advantage. A surprisingly slow start to the season has given way to typical Fitzgerald numbers. In the last two weeks, the Pro Bowl receiver has 18 catches for 179 yards and three touchdowns. After seeing what the Saints receivers did to New York last Sunday, Fitzgerald will no doubt be itching to attack the Giants' secondary.

This could be a high-scoring game. Eli Manning against Kurt Warner should be fun. It will be close, although both teams have doubts, what has that heavy defeat done to the Giants confidence and the Cardinals are not the greatest of road teams.

RECOMMENDATION: Over 46.5 match points 1 point at [2.0] or better.
